Curiosidades sobre la música Streets of Baltimore del Gram Parsons

¿En qué álbumes fue lanzada la canción “Streets of Baltimore” por Gram Parsons?
Gram Parsons lanzó la canción en los álbumes “Gram Parsons & The Fallen Angels: Live 1973” en 1973, “GP” en 1973, “Live 1973” en 1982, “Sacred Hearts & Fallen Angels: The Gram Parsons Anthology” en 2001 y “The Complete Reprise Sessions” en 2006.
¿Quién compuso la canción “Streets of Baltimore” de Gram Parsons?
La canción “Streets of Baltimore” de Gram Parsons fue compuesta por Harlan Howard, Tompall Glaser.
